Description

COLLECTION ALBUM FOR PICTURES, IN PARTICULAR PHOTOGRAPHS AND THOSE OF LARGE DIMENSIONS This invention relates to a collection album for pictures which in 5 addition to normal-size pictures is able in particular to contain pictures of large dimensions.
A collection album for pictures, for example photographs, is often required to contain photographs of large dimensions, exceeding the normal dimensions of the sheets of a collection album.
To satisfy this requirement, the present invention provides a collection album for pictures, in particular photographs and those of large dimensions, comprising a plurality of bound sheets each consisting of several variously cut, superposed and joinedtogether layers of a suitable material, such as paper or cardboard, which comprise a central support for supporting a passe-partout picture holder, on at least one of the faces of said support there being joined further layers defining perimetral frames of 3aid central support which are able to retain said picture holder in position, characterised in that said picture holder consists of a sheet foldable into at least two parts, of which the lower part is of such dimensions as to be able to be inserted into and retained by said perimetral frame of the album - 2 sheet, whereas the upper part is of smaller dimensions than the other so as to be able to be freely opened without interfering with said perimetral frame, the pair of inner faces of said two parts hence being able to receive a single large-dimension picture.
The characteristics and advantages of the present invention will be more apparent from the description given hereinafter with reference to the accompanying schematic drawings, in which: Figure 1 is a perspective view of a photograph album according to the invention in which a picture holder is shown at the moment of its insertion; Figure 2 is a view of a sheet of the album of Figure 1 into which a picture holder has been inserted; Figure 3 is a highly enlarged sectional view of the sheet taken on the line IIIā€”III of Figure 2, and from which the picture holder has been extracted; and Figure 4 is a perspective view analogous to that of Figure 1 but in a different position of use, in which the picture holder has been inserted into the album sheet and is in its open position.
With reference to said figures, a photograph album according to the invention comprises a series of sheets 1 held together by a binding 2.
Each of said sheets 1 consists of a plurality of superposed layers of various thicknesses and shapes, joined together for example by gluing.
In the example shown in the figures they comprise a central support layer 3 for supporting at least one picture 4 on its upper - 3 face 5 and a picture 4' on its lower face 5'. The picture 4 is fixed to a passe-partout picture holder 16, and the picture 4' to a picture holder 16'.
On each of said faces 5 and 5' of the central support 3 there is 5 fixed a second layer 6 of cardboard, for example glued to the layer 3 along an upper edge 7 and a lower edge 8 and along the vertical edge 9 in the binding region. The opposite edge 10 of the support 3 is not glued to the layer 6, and hence defines a passage 11 for inserting or withdrawing the picture holder, as can be seen in Figure 1.
The layer 6 is apertured to assume the form of a perimetral frame, the dimensions of which correspond to those of the picture holder as explained hereinafter.
On the layer 6 there is glued a further superposed layer 12, which is also in the form of a perimetral frame superposed on that of the layer 6 but with a slightly smaller aperture, so that a step 13 is defined between them to act as a guide for inserting and withdrawing the picture holder 16, as a limit stop for its insertion and as a retention means for fixing the inserted picture holder.
This sheet configuration is repeated symmetrically on the other face 5' of the central layer, which hence also carries a pair of layers 6 and 12 identical to those described for the face 5.
As can be seen in Figure 3, a vertical cut 14 can be suitably made along the edge 9 of each sheet 1 in the binding region 2, and which in the present example is made through the two layers 6, so that sheet continuity in the region of the cut 14 is provided only - 4 by the two layers 12, which are glued together. The vertical cut 14 hence defines a hinging or articulation axis about which the portion 15 of the sheet to which the picture is fixed can be bent freely along 14 relative to that sheet portion lying between the binding and the cutting axis; this characteristic is the subject of a copending utility model application by the present applicant. According to the objects of the present invention, one or more of the album sheets 1 can contain a picture holder 16 having the structure shown in Figures 1 and 4. The said picture holder 16 consists - in the example shown in said figures - of two sheets 17 and 18 joined together, for example by gluing, along the vertical edge 19. The sheet 18 is whole and is of such dimensions as to adapt perfectly to the seat on the album sheet 1 defined as heretofore described by the perimetral frame formed between the layers 6 and 12, and the step 13. The sheet 17 of the picture holder 16 is of slightly smaller dimensions than the sheet 18, so than when this latter has been inserted and held in position in the album sheet 1, the sheet 17 of the picture holder can be freely opened and closed above the sheet 18 without interfering with the perimetral frame of the sheet 1 which retains the sheet in position. It therefore becomes possible to fix a large20 dimension picture/onto the upper face of the sheet 18 and inner face of the sheet 17, and which could not be fixed on a picture holder of normal dimensions. The said picture 20 is obviously folded along the edge 19 of the picture holder 16.
A picture 4 of normal dimensions can be fixed on the outer face of the sheet 17 of the picture holder 16, as shown in Figure 1. If - 5 after viewing the picture 4 it is desired to view the large picture 20, it is therefore sufficient merely to open the picture holder 16 into the position shown in Figure 4.
As an alternative to the example shown in the drawings, the 5 picture holder can consist of a single sheet foldable along the edge 19 into two pages 17 and 18, provided the page 17 is trimmed to smaller dimensions than the page 18. In this respect, this latter has to be able to be inserted into or withdrawn from, and retained by, the perimetral frame of the sheet 1, whereas the page 17 has to be able to be freely opened and closed when the page 18 is inserted into the sheet 1.
Numerous other modifications on the example shown in the accompanying drawings can be provided.
